CDR Robert N. Harris III
EXECUTIVE OFFICER, USS WILLIAM P. LAWRENCE (DDG 110)

Commander Robert N. Harris III, a native of West Hollywood, California, is a 2005 graduate of the Army and Navy Academy high school in Carlsbad, California. He graduated from the United States Naval Academy in 2009 with a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ering. Following his commissioning, he attended the Naval Postgraduate School, where he earned a Master of Science in Mechanical Engineering with a subspecialty in Total Ship Systems Engineering in 2010. He has also completed a graduate certificate in Operations Analysis from the Naval Postgraduate School.
Afloat, Commander Harris completed his Division Officer tours as the Communications Officer on USS CHAFEE (DDG 90) in Pearl Harbor, Hawaii, and as a Reactor Controls Division Officer aboard USS GEORGE H.W. BUSH (CVN 77) in Norfolk, Virginia. For his Department Head tours, he served as the Plans and Tactics Officer on USS ROSS (DDG 71), forward-deployed to Rota, Spain, and as the Reactor Electrical Assistant on USS CARL VINSON (CVN 70). His operational experience includes multiple deployments to the U.S. Fifth, Sixth, and Seventh Fleet areas of operation.
Ashore, his assignments include service as a nuclear engineer at Naval Reactors Headquarters (NAVSEA 08) in Washington, D.C.; on the Commander, U.S. Pacific Fleet Nuclear Propulsion Examination Board in Pearl Harbor, Hawaii, inspecting submarines and aircraft carriers; and at the Joint Interagency Task Force West at U.S. Indo-Pacific Command.
